Pro-Palestine protesters have been under fire for bringing Australia’s biggest shopping centre to a halt on Boxing Day.
On the morning of Dec. 26, a small group of protesters made their way to Chadstone shopping centre in Melbourne where more than 150,000 shoppers braved the crowds to snap up a bargain after a year made more difficult by a cost-of-living crisis.
